AUDREY LYNN ROCHE October 1, 1945 - October 14, 2017 It is with great sadness we announce the passing of our wife, mother, grandmother and friend, Audrey, aged 72, at the Health Sciences Centre. Audrey is survived by her loving husband Gordon; sister Gail; son Jeff; daughter Danielle (Chris); grandchildren Tanner, Hilary, Noah and Andrew will also miss her dearly. She also leaves behind her stepfamily Karen, Stuart (Sharri), Scott, Cameron, Sarah and Emma. Her nieces Holly and Angel, and nephew Chris were also very special to her. Audrey was predeceased by her parents John and Elsa, and her loving husband of 22 years, Garnet Walters. Audrey was born in Winnipeg, but spent the last 39 years in Petersfield, living most of those years on her beloved Netley Creek. Audrey grew up in St. Vital, was married to Gil Dufort from 1968 to 1974 (father of Jeff and Danielle) and remained the closest of friends no matter where their lives took them. In 1978, she met Garnet, to whom she would marry and spend 22 loving years until his passing in 2000. How lucky was she in 2005 to be introduced to Gordon, whom she would marry in 2009. Gordon and Audrey would travel North America, making new friends wherever they went. A Happy Hour at Gordon and Audrey's was full of fun, friends and always love. Audrey and Gordon joined their families seamlessly. While a person's life is sometimes measured by their accomplishments and credits, it should always be measured by the impact they had on others. For those of us left behind, there will be a void left by the vivacious, caring, and compassionate Audrey, our mother, our grandmother, our friend, our wife. Audrey's greatest loves were her family, her many, many friends, especially "the Girls", and of course her furbabies. Her special little girl Rexie will keep her chair warm. We will miss her so.
